BMDs and Church Records

Birth, marriage and death records, (BMDs) and church records are the foundation of genealogical research. These are the records that anchor our ancestors in a place and time and help us to make connections between them. Unfortunately, BMD records are sometimes not easy to find. Free Genealogy Websites

You don’t have to spend a lot of money doing online genealogy research. There are many free websites available in the U.S. and other countries. The Family History Library, www.familysearch.org, includes many indexes, pedigree files, and the Family History Library catalog. U.S. records include state and federal census records.
